Escrita con maestria y ritmo poetico por el ganador del Premio de Novela Historica Grijalbo-Claustro de Sor Juana 2019, Ignacio Casas, Amelio, mi coronel es una obra repleta de pasajes emocionantes, un homenaje a la vida que uno elige.ENGLISH DESCRIPTIONBased on real events, Amelio, My Colonel rescues from oblivion one of the most exciting and unique characters of the Mexican Revolution, one who rebelliously broke the molds of the time. A novel that reminds us that destiny is forged, even with bullets. At age twenty-one, wearing petticoats and a shawl, Malaquias Amelia de Jesus joined the Liberation Army of the South, alongside Casimira, her beloved and deceased fathers pistol, and also the willful spirit that characterized him so much. It was there, on the battlefield, among death and displacements, but also among loves and victories, where she found the strength to shout his new name: Amelio! Admired and respected by generals, captains, and even by the troops, Amelio Robles fought alongside notable revolutionaries like Chon Diaz, Heliodoro Castillo, Adrian Castrejon and, of course, Emiliano Zapata. As a colonel, he led more than five hundred soldiers, fighting against the enemy, as well as against those who questioned his identity. Masterfully written with poetic rhythm by Ignacio Casas, winner of the 2019 Grijalbo-Claustro de Sor Juana Historical Novel Award, Amelio, My Colonel is a moving work full of poignant passages, and a tribute to the life one chooses. ENGLISH DESCRIPTION Winner of the Grijalbo - Sister Juana Cloisters Historical Novel Award. Sister Juana Ines de la Cruz's slave was also in her own way, a disciple, the first to hear verses, sonnets, and quatrains. A mulatto woman whose adventures and unforeseen events excite us and allow us to discover the contrasts of the New Spain of the 17th Century. In love with the possibility of deciphering what the letters say when put together, Yara follows in the steps of the mother poet. She heeds the orders of the nuns of the San Geronimo convent. She listens to the turner's advice. But, above all, she is guided by momentum, by that internal fire that always leads to entertaining mutiny. Juan Ines's Slave is a story that fans mischievousness, nurtures poetic language, and rescues from historical oblivion a character as real as imagined.
